Speed MI Up Incubator Seeks Innovative Startups

, by Claudio Todesco
The new tender for 15 new entrants opens on October 3. The winning ideas will gain access to two years of value added services. A third office space soon to be opened

Speed MI Up seeks 15 new startups with international, viable and innovative ideas – not only in technological terms. The startups can access the services of the Speed MI Up incubator (www.speedmiup.it), via the new tender that opens today, Monday, March 6 and closes Friday, April 14.

The selected entrepreneurs will gain access to numerous value-added services: tutorship by the Bocconi faculty; periodical business reviews conducted by an Advisory Board; training by Bocconi, SDA Bocconi and Formaper staff; a Consulting Bureau on legal, financing, marketing and digital media; networking with investors; knowledge sharing meetings.

Some services are offered by Speed MI Up's partners: UBI Banca (funding), PwC (advice on tax and legal issues), Mediamatic (digital communication plans), Imageware (communication and media planning), Aruba (cloud computing), and, from now on: Amazon Web Services (clous computing services and Studio Franzosi Dal Negro Setti (legal services).

The tender is reserved for aspiring entrepreneurs and startups established over the last 20 months. The selection committee will rate the startups based on an elevator pitch (a video of 3 minutes maximum), a business plan, participants' resumes and, in some cases, an interview. Startuppers can find in the Speed Mi Up website a 12-hour videocourse teaching them how to draw up a business plan and directions about the making of the elevator pitch.


Launched in 2013 and at its ninth tender, the incubator can already show some success stories such as Cercaofficina.it (online quotes research for car repairs), D1 Milan (watches), Diferente (drinks with no alcohol), My Cooking Box (the chef in a box), One Tray (sponsored trays for security checks at airports), Quattrocento (eyeglasses' ecommerce), Mind the Gum (food supplement in the form of chewing gum) and Wash Out (home car wash service).

Unlike other incubators, Speed MI Up does not enter the capital of the startups, thus preserving their value and entrepreneurial freedom

Bocconi University, Milan Chamber of Commerce and the City of Milan, the promoters of Speed Up MI, offer up to 15 seats, and the notice is directed both to entrepreneurs and to startups established over the past 20 months. Startups may be located anywhere, but will have to transfer to the province of Milan within three months.

It offers a period of incubation and acceleration, which includes two years of incubation and five more years, during which startups will continue to take advantage of some of the services offered by the incubator. In the near future a third office space will open in via Bocconi, the quarters of via Gobbi 5 and via Achille Papa 30.
